#bc5003 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bc5003 is composed of 73.7% red, 31.4%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 57.4% magenta, 98.4%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 25 degrees, a saturation of 96.9% and a lightness of 37.5%. #bc5003 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a006 with #790000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

Shades and Tints of #bc5003
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0600 is the darkest color, while #fffc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#bc5003
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#645f5b is the less saturated color, while #bc5003 is the most saturated one.
